在现代信息时代,网络安全已经成为各个组织和个人关注的焦点。安全漏洞是网络安全中最常见的问题之一,它们可能被恶意攻击者利用,从而导致数据泄露、系统瘫痪等严重后果。本文将详细介绍破解安全漏洞的两种关键步骤,帮助读者了解如何有效地防御和应对安全漏洞。
第一步:识别和评估安全漏洞
1.1 安全漏洞的类型
安全漏洞可以分为以下几类:
- 设计缺陷:在系统设计阶段存在的缺陷,可能导致系统无法按照预期工作。
- 实现错误:在软件实现过程中出现的错误,可能导致程序执行不正确。
- 配置错误:系统配置不当,使得系统面临安全风险。
- 软件依赖性:系统依赖的第三方组件存在安全漏洞。
1.2 识别安全漏洞的方法
为了识别安全漏洞,可以采取以下几种方法:
- 自动扫描工具:使用如Nessus、OpenVAS等自动化扫描工具,对系统进行全面的安全检查。
- 手动检查:通过深入分析系统架构、代码和配置文件,寻找潜在的安全漏洞。
- 渗透测试:模拟黑客攻击,检验系统的安全防御能力。
1.3 评估安全漏洞的影响
在识别安全漏洞后,需要对其影响进行评估。评估内容包括:
- 漏洞的严重程度:根据漏洞的潜在危害程度,将其分为高、中、低三个等级。
- 漏洞的利用难度:分析攻击者利用该漏洞的难度,包括技术要求、所需资源等。
- 漏洞的修复成本:修复漏洞所需的资源,包括时间、人力和财力。
第二步:修复和加固安全漏洞
2.1 修复安全漏洞
修复安全漏洞通常包括以下步骤:
- 更新和打补丁:及时更新系统和应用程序,安装安全补丁。
- 修改配置:调整系统配置,降低安全风险。
- 代码修复:修复代码中的错误,消除潜在的安全漏洞。
2.2 加固安全防御体系
在修复安全漏洞后,需要采取以下措施加固安全防御体系:
- 访问控制:限制对系统资源的访问权限,确保只有授权用户才能访问。
- 防火墙和入侵检测系统:部署防火墙和入侵检测系统,实时监控网络流量,防止恶意攻击。
- 安全意识培训:提高员工的安全意识,防止内部人员泄露敏感信息。
总结
破解安全漏洞是网络安全工作中的一项重要任务。通过识别和评估安全漏洞,修复和加固安全防御体系,可以有效降低安全风险,保障系统安全稳定运行。在实际操作中,需要结合具体情况进行综合分析和判断,以确保网络安全。